SWEET HEAT JALAPENO RELISH

I found a jar of Sweet Jalapeno Relish at the store and tried it and fell in love. I searched many recipes and not being a canner or having pickling ingredients on hand I went with the simplest recipe I found for a water/sugar ratio and added roasted red bell since I felt like pimentos would be a great addition as well as seeing what I believed were pimentos in the relish I bought. After simmering slightly I realized it was missing the pickle flavor the bought relish had so I added the dill chips. This turned so good and hotter than the store bought.

Number Of Ingredients 5

1 pound(s) fresh jalapenos
1 cup(s) dill pickle chips
12 oz jar(s) roasted red bell pepper
2 cup(s) water
1 1/4 cup(s) granulated sugar

Steps:

  • Cut stems off of jalapenos and cut into halves or thirds. You may need to do the pulsing in two batches. Add jarred bell pepper and dill pickle chips. Pulse till finely chopped.
  • In med size pan heat water and sugar. Add chopped veggies and simmer on very low for an hour or until water is absorbed or evaporated. Cool and place in jar. Refrigerate.
